Dell Portables POST Bitmap Update Program soll es laut Dell ermöglichen die Dell-Werbung, die beim Booten angezeigt, wird zu entfernen und durch ein eigenes Bild zu ersetzten:
„The POST Bitmap Update Program allows you to replace the image that is
displayed during the Power-On Self Test (POST) of your Dell Portable
computer. By default, the image displayed during POST is the Dell logo. This image can
be replaced by a specially formatted image loaded into non-volatile memory
(NVRAM) using SPLASH.EXE. The image remains in memory even when power has
been removed from the system.
The image which is loaded into NVRAM must be in bitmap (.bmp) format. The
image can be no larger than 640 pixels wide by 480 pixels high and must use
16 colors.“
